WebCompared with sulfonylureas, metformin has been associated with a lower risk of kidney function decline or death, independent of changes in body mass index, systolic blood pressure, and glycated hemoglobin. Metformin doesn’t cause kidney damage. The kidneys process and clear the medication out of your system through your urine. If your kidneys don’t function properly, there’s concern that metformin can build up in your system and cause a condition called lactic acidosis.
